    Who is Dr. Rugg, Emergency Medicine Specialist in Holden, MA?

    Dr. Peter Rugg, MD is an Emergency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Holden, MA with 1 additional practice location. He has been practicing for over 37 years and is board certified by the American Board of Emergency Medicine and American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Rugg completed his residency at Worcester City Hosp, Internal Medicine; Worcester Mem Hosp-Im/Pth, Internal Medicine; U Ma Mem Hlthcare-Univ Campus, Internal Medicine.     What is Dr. Peter Rugg's specialty?

    Dr. Rugg is a Emergency Medicine Specialist near Holden, MA. An emergency physician is dedicated to making prompt decision and taking necessary actions essential for preventing death or additional disabilities. This role encompasses guiding emergency medical technicians in pre-hospital environments as well as providing care within the emergency department. The emergency physician is responsible for the immediate identification, evaluation, treatment, stabilization, and arrangement of a diverse array of adult and pediatric patients facing acute illnesses and injuries.
